Gold-Silver Price Today: There is a rise in gold prices in India today. After the fall in the beginning of the week, now gold seems to be back on track. There has been a huge jump in the price of gold in the last two sessions. During this period, the price of 100 grams of 24 carat gold has increased by approximately Rs 39800 and the price of 22 carat gold of the same gram has increased by Rs 36500. This shows the re-increasing interest of people in gold.
This rise in gold prices is happening due to different signals regarding possible peace talks between America and Iran. On one hand, America has sent a peace proposal to Iran through Pakistan. On the other hand, Iran has denied any desire to join the talks. On top of that, it has placed the condition of its complete authority (sovereign control) over the Strait of Hormuz. This has again taken the tension to its peak. About 20 percent of the world’s crude oil passes through this route. In such a situation, any kind of control here is worrying for the global economy.
gold price today
24 carat
Today the price of 24 carat gold per gram is Rs 14689, which is Rs 22 more than yesterday’s Rs 14667. At the same time, with an increase of Rs 176, today the price of 8 grams 24 carat gold is Rs 1,17,512. The price of 10 grams has increased by Rs 220 to Rs 1,46,890 and the price of 100 grams has increased by Rs 2,200 to Rs 14,68,900.
22 carat
A continuous increase was seen in the prices of gold in the 22 carat category also. The price of 1 gram today is Rs 13,465, which is Rs 20 more than the previous session. The rate for 8 grams increased to Rs 1,07,720, an increase of Rs 160 compared to yesterday. The price of 10 grams has increased by Rs 200 to Rs 1,34,650, while the price of 100 grams has increased by Rs 2,000 to Rs 13,46,500.
18 carat
Today gold prices increased in 18 carat segment also. The rate of 1 gram is Rs 11,017, which is Rs 16 more. The price for 8 grams increased to Rs 88,136, an increase of Rs 128. The rate of 10 grams increased to Rs 1,10,170, which is Rs 160 more, while the price of 100 grams is Rs 11,01,700, an increase of Rs 1,600.
What is the price of silver?
Today silver prices in India are Rs 240 per gram and Rs 2,40,000 per kilogram. Amid global uncertainty, a huge fall in the price of silver in the country today is seen by up to Rs 10,000 per kg.
